Poverty Reduction in Mongolia considers the many aspects of poverty in Mongolia - population movements and capabilities, environmental constraints, macroeconomic policy, and governance. It forms the basis of a strategy to counter the economic decline, the growth of poverty and the increasing reliance on foreign aid. At the heart of this strategy is the notion that there need be no conflict between growth and equity. It argues that Mongolia now needs a strong state that is able to guide the transition process, to create new institutions, to introduce economic reforms, to finance public investment and to help those who, despite their best efforts, are unable to help themselves.Book Details
